Description
Cville FoodLink connects local Charlottesville volunteers with residents who request food delivery from grocery stores, restaurants, and food pantries. These volunteers can then view and accept nearby requests, while chatting safely in-app. Cville FoodLink essentially functions as a volunteer marketplace, giving the community another option when it comes to dealing with age-related mobility issues, disease, and disabilities. Additionally, through a review and report system, users actively contribute to a caring community network.
Features:
-The Request Tab allows those in need to submit specific requests for volunteer help. There is no limit to any request, whether it's the delivery of an online order or a specific grocery list.
-The Volunteer Dashboard serves as a holding place for all open requests. Each request's location is generalized to give volunteers a sense of where the request is located, without compromising privacy.
-The Map Tab gives volunteers a sense of which areas of their community need the most help. No exact locations are ever shown.
-The app includes an in-app messaging system where users can exchange contact info and details regarding the food request.
-Volunteers can leave reviews and reports about their experience.
